The Long Arm
1956· NR· 1h 36m· Crime· Mystery· Thriller
“The True Inside Story of Scotland Yard's Crime Busters!”
Scotland Yard detectives attempt to solve a spate of safe robberies across England beginning with clues found at the latest burglary in London. The film is notable for using a police procedural style made popular by Ealing in their 1950 film The Blue Lamp. It is known in the US as The Third Key.
